Product Overview

Déjà Dup
Déjà Dup

Description: Déjà Dup is a simple backup tool included in GNOME desktop environments. It allows users to backup files and folders to local, remote, or cloud storage on a schedule. Déjà Dup has a clean interface and aims to make backups effortless.

Type: software

Pricing: Free

FSArchiver
FSArchiver

Description: FSArchiver is an open-source system tool for creating and restoring backups of partitions and file systems. It supports various file systems like ext2, ext3, ext4, btrfs, and xfs. FSArchiver compresses and archives the file system into a streamlined image file that can be securely stored.
